Profile / Experience

I am a Solicitor in the Family and Child Care department at Duncan Lewis Solicitors. I joined in April 2019 and am based in the Shepherd’s Bush office. I work in a team of solicitors, trainees and caseworkers under the supervision of childcare director, Sophie Fretten.

I have experience dealing with Private Children and Public Law Proceedings. I undertake both publicly and privately funded work. My expertise in Public Law includes representing clients in care proceedings, Child Protection Conferences and PLO Outlines. I have experience assisting vulnerable clients with learning difficulties, substance and alcohol misuse and those who have been victims of domestic abuse. I have also assisted in child care cases representing parents in cases concerning emotional abuse, physical neglect and sexual abuse.

I have existing experience in child care proceedings from my time working at Surrey County Council where I worked with a team of solicitors, social workers and court staff preparing hearing bundles. As a result, I can expertly manage a caseload and have experience using the Family Court’s Digital Case System. I represent individuals in regard to private children matters, including Child Arrangement Orders, Specific Issue Orders and Prohibited Steps Orders. I also have experience representing Applicants and Respondents to Non-Molestation and Occupation Orders. I have assisted a number of clients who have been victims of domestic violence and regularly provide a pro bono legal advice service for the Latin American Women’s Rights Services (LAWRS) and other charities.
